Enjoying the Cricket 🏏 in the Sunshine ☀️
Tautoru’s PE focus for term one is ball skills. We have been practising throwing and catching with a range of ball sizes and our skills are already improving! Alongside practising our fundamental movement skills, we will be playing a range of ball games and have a trip to the ASB Centre in the works for later this term.
On Tuesday, as part of our practice, we had our friends from Cricket Wellington come and teach us the basic skills of cricket. Our tamariki practised recall speeds, throwing, bowling and batting!
